Climate and Commodity Trading
Commodities are particularly sensitive to climate variations. Here’s how traders can use climate data to their advantage.
Impact on Agricultural Commodities
- Crop Yields: Weather patterns directly affect yield sizes and quality.
- Market Prices: Fluctuations based on supply and demand changes due to climate.
Energy Markets
- Oil and Gas: Weather can affect production rates and distribution.
- Renewable Energy Sources: Solar and wind energies are directly influenced by weather conditions.
